The US Open is one of the four major tennis tournaments and the perfect excuse to explore the Big Apple. On this trip, we'll get one full day of tennis at the Flushing Meadows, as well as a night session in the Arthur Ashe stadium on a separate day, where we'll get to see the best players in the world. Djokovic, Nadal, Alcaraz, Iga, Coco Gauff... hopefully they're all participating in this tournament. The experience of being at the venue almost all day is just something incredible. From watching lower-ranked players just a few meters away from you to watching them practice, witnessing the greatness of the big stadiums, and the hope of running into one of the players, the US Open is something all tennis fans need to do once in a lifetime. We'll stay in New York City the whole week. There's so much to see and do that there's no need to add another stop. We'll walk around Manhattan, Queens, Brooklyn, the Bronx and even take a short trip to Staten Island so you can visit the five boroughs that compose New York City. The first stop will be Manhattan to get a good feeling of the Big Apple, all its buildings and most popular attractions. From Harlem and Central Park to the Financial District, be sure that we'll see most of the island.

This is where the US Open takes place, so we'll visit this area for 2 days during our trip. The subway takes us there from anywhere in New York City; it's a very nice line with new trains and nice views. We can also walk around Corona Park, a really nice place with tons of trees and beautiful views.

We'll cross the Brooklyn bridge and walk around some of its nicest neighborhoods, such as Brooklyn Heights and Dumbo. The famous pizza place Grimaldi's is here, in case someone has it as a must on their list. In addition, we'll visit Williamsburgh, a hip neighborhood where we can grab a bite or a drink; as well as Long Island City in Queens, a beautiful place to take pictures of Manhattan's skyline.
